Operational Technology Security Program Specialist

  

We're looking for an Operational Technology Security Program Specialist to establish and mature BYU’s cybersecurity program for the systems that support campus operations. This role will serve as a key liaison among Information Technology, Physical Facilities, security operations, Risk Management, vendors, and other partners. You’ll develop security governance, assess and reduce risk, and improve monitoring and incident response for operational technology environments. The ideal candidate can balance cybersecurity needs with operational continuity, safety, and the unique requirements of OT systems (campus physical facilities not factory/manufacturing).

 

What you'll do in this role

  • Establish and advance BYU’s Operational Technology Security Program.

  • Develop and maintain OT cybersecurity policies, standards, procedures, and implementation guidelines.

  • Define governance structures, roles, responsibilities, risk acceptance processes, and a multi-year security roadmap.

  • Conduct OT risk assessments and integrate OT risks into enterprise risk management processes.

  • Maintain OT asset inventories, classifications, system documentation, and network diagrams.

  • Review OT architectures, projects, and technology deployments to ensure security requirements are addressed.

  • Evaluate controls such as network segmentation, remote access, system hardening, access management, and monitoring.

  • Develop OT-specific monitoring requirements, detection use cases, incident response procedures, and continuity plans.

  • Coordinate security assessments, tabletop exercises, incident reviews, remediation activities, and risk reporting.

  • Collaborate with facilities, engineering, security operations, vendors, and other stakeholders to improve OT security while preserving reliability and safety.

What qualifies you for this role

  • Bachelor’s degree in cybersecurity, information technology, engineering, facilities management, industrial technology, or a related field—or an equivalent combination of education and experience.

  • Experience developing, implementing, or supporting cybersecurity, operational technology, industrial control systems, building automation systems, or related programs.

  • Experience conducting risk assessments, security audits, compliance reviews, or incident response activities.

  • Knowledge of cybersecurity governance, risk management, and security control frameworks.

  • Understanding of the safety, availability, reliability, and operational requirements of OT environments.

  • Strong written, verbal, collaboration, and stakeholder-management skills.

  • Familiarity with the NIST Cybersecurity Framework, NIST SP 800-82, ISA/IEC 62443, or related OT security guidance is preferred.

  • Experience with building automation systems, facilities technologies, critical infrastructure, higher education, healthcare, utilities, or similar operational environments is preferred.
